Skip to content

Документация по BlackArch на русском языке

Инструкции, советы, новые программы

Menu
  • Главная
  • Список инструментов
  • HackWare
Menu

Как установить CAL++ в BlackArch / Arch

Posted on 02.02.201607.10.2016 by Alexey

Эта инструкция является частью цикла:

  • Как установить AMD/ATI Catalyst драйверы AKA Crimson 15.12 в BlackArch / Arch Linux с ядром 4.7 или 4.8
  • Как установить AMD APP SDK в BlackArch / Arch
  • Как установить CAL++ в BlackArch / Arch [данная статья]
  • Установка Pyrit в BlackArch / Arch
  • Установка Hashcat в BlackArch / Arch

Предполагается, что у вас уже установлен проприетарный драйвер AMD, а также AMD APP SDK, иначе следовать этой инструкции не имеет смысла.

CAL++ — это простая библиотека, позволяющая писать напрямую в ядра ATI CAL на C++. Синтакис очень схож с OpenCL. Также включены оболочки C++ для CAL.

Подготовка к установке:

sudo pacman -S cmake boost --needed

Загрузка CAL++

Загрузите calpp 0.90 с веб-сайта SourceForge CAL++

wget http://sourceforge.net/projects/calpp/files/calpp-0.90/calpp-0.90.tar.gz
cd ~/Downloads
tar -xvf calpp-0.90.tar.gz
cd calpp-0.90/

Отредактируем файл CMakeLists.txt:

gedit CMakeLists.txt

Найдём строки, которые начинаются с FIND_LIBRARY и FIND_PATH и заменим их на эти:

FIND_LIBRARY( LIB_ATICALCL aticalcl PATHS "$ENV{ATISTREAMSDKROOT}" )
FIND_LIBRARY( LIB_ATICALRT aticalrt PATHS "$ENV{ATISTREAMSDKROOT}" )
FIND_PATH( LIB_ATICAL_INCLUDE NAMES cal.h calcl.h PATHS "$ENV{ATISTREAMSDKROOT}/include/CAL" )

Собираем и устанавливаем CAL++

Наберите следующие команды:

cmake .
make
sudo make install

Близкие статьи

  • Установка проприетарных драйверов AMD (Catalyst 15.9) на BlackArch / Arch (100%)
  • Как установить AMD APP SDK в BlackArch / Arch (100%)
  • Установка Pyrit в BlackArch / Arch (100%)
  • Установка Hashcat в BlackArch / Arch (100%)
  • Как установить AMD/ATI Catalyst драйверы AKA Crimson 15.12 в BlackArch / Arch Linux с ядром 4.7, 4.8, 4.9, 4.10, 4.11 (100%)
  • Установка BlackArch, часть первая: Установка BlackArch в VirtualBox (RANDOM - 50%)

Добавить комментарий Отменить ответ

Ваш адрес email не будет опубликован. Обязательные поля помечены *

wp-puzzle.com logo

Поиск

Свежие записи

  • Ошибки «Incorrect definition of table mysql.event: expected column ‘definer’ at position 3 to have type varchar(, found type char(141)» и «Event Scheduler: An error occurred when initializing system tables. Disabling the Event Scheduler» (РЕШЕНО)
  • Как скачать пакет без установки в Arch Linux и Manjaro. Как скачать исходный код пакета AUR
  • Ошибка «не удалось завершить транзакцию (неверный или поврежденный пакет)» (РЕШЕНО)
  • Изменения в пакете linux-firmware: требования к ядру, выделение больших файлов в отдельные пакеты
  • Ошибка error: failed to synchronize all databases (unable to lock database) (РЕШЕНО)

Свежие комментарии

  • vlad к записи Ошибка «не удалось завершить транзакцию (неверный или поврежденный пакет)» (РЕШЕНО)
  • vlad к записи Как увеличить мощность (TX-Power) Wi-Fi карты в BlackArch
  • Alexey к записи Как установить программу из Arch User Repository (AUR) – пользовательского репозитория Arch
  • archlinux к записи Как установить программу из Arch User Repository (AUR) – пользовательского репозитория Arch
  • Alexey к записи Установка Дополнений гостевой ОС VirtualBox для BlackArch (Arch Linux)




Рубрики

  • Sniffing и Spoofing
  • Архив
  • Взлом Wi-Fi сетей
  • Инструкции
  • Новости
  • Общая информация/новости
  • Разведка
  • Справка и подсказки




Яндекс.Метрика
© 2022 Документация по BlackArch на русском языке | Powered by Minimalist Blog WordPress Theme